Output 77fdf59a3476e6112fe8b471e945b1f342bdc5175916b3a4c2743b8b1ed752a7:1

value
18963000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4557917a31d322f080b02949ea2b4e8c2818504 OP_EQUAL
address
MUiUgwHpxrqmXF6BdhS4BQeVqrm54Jz5ST
transaction
77fdf59a3476e6112fe8b471e945b1f342bdc5175916b3a4c2743b8b1ed752a7
spent
true